Add replica set configurations to the configuration file on each server and restart after that. Start or stop the monitoring agent mongodb cloud manager. Debeziums mongodb connector tracks a mongodb replica set or a mongodb. Apr 23, 2020 mongodb then uses this oplog to replicate the writes to the other members in the replica set. When the restore job completes, click get link for each replica set appears. Exploring the replication and sharding in mongodb youtube. Aug 07, 2017 on each replica set member its recommended to install the same version of mongodb.
Use standalone instances for testing and development. On windows, services can be stopped and started from the task manager or from the services. Ops manager supports shutting down individual mongod and mongos processes, as well as replica sets and sharded clusters. My workaround was just to kill all containers related. Restore a replica set from a snapshot mongodb cloud manager.
Stop, restart, or terminate a backup mongodb cloud manager. If file not present, mongodb will create the file as configured in the configuration file. Stop the monitoring agent on windows in windows control panel, open administrative tools and then services. Do not use these deployments for production systems as they lack replication and high availability. If this folder does not exist mongodb will not start. To be completely sure that the replica set configuration is gone from the instance, make sure that the local. You can select an existing replica set or create a new one. The secondary nodes, in the other end, replicate the primarys operation log and apply the operations to their data set such that their data sets. Each shard consist of replica set that provides redundancy and high availability. Stop, restart, or terminate a backup mongodb ops manager 4. This is a major change as cloud manager does require you to inspect and fix your failed nodes manually. Dont let your standalone mongodb server stand alone. Each arm template is licensed to you under a licence agreement by its owner, not microsoft. This setting corresponds to the tags mongod replica set configuration option.
In the list of services, select mongodb monitoring agent. For existing groups, your groupproject id remains the same. Some binary data stored in a snapshot may be bindata subtype 2. The most common way is to just stop the mongod, since you must restart the mongod without the replica option to actually stop it from trying to use the replica set. Setup a mongodb cluster aka replica set on ubuntu after one day and a half, bouncing between various resources, i finally managed to make a mongodb replica set work. If using a package manager, add a new repository for the 3. How to deploy a mongodb sharded cluster on centos 7. This command will show the size of the log and how long it can hold transactions in its log file before it becomes full.
For complete documentation on replica set tags, see replica set tags. See replica set secondary members for more information. Replica sets allow a mongodb deployment to remain available during the majority of a maintenance window this document outlines the basic procedure for performing maintenance on each of the members of a replica set. Click the member of the replica set that you want to view. Is there a defined behavior for this if it is run on a primary of a replica set. This option provides a grouping for all servers which will be part of this replica set. Timestamp in iso 8601 date and time format in utc when this alert configuration was last updated enabled. You can deploy a standalone mongodb instance for cloud manager to manage. Atlas can perform a live migration of a source replica set to an atlas cluster, keeping the cluster in sync with the remote source until you cut your applications over to the atlas cluster.
Mongodb s jira will be unavailable for scheduled maintenance from 14. For example, i have a replica set of 3 members, one primary mongodb running on port 27017 and two secondary, mongodb1 on port 37017, and mongodb2 on port 47017. To check the oplog, connect to the required member instance and run the rs. Displays the time required to replicate operations from the primary to the secondary members of a replica set. Mongodb compass, the gui for mongodb, is the easiest way to explore and manipulate your data. For example, i have a replica set of 3 members, one primary mongodb running on port 27017 and two secondary, mongodb1 on port 37017, and mongodb2 on. Available only for secondary members of a replica set. When the initial sync finishes, the member transitions from startup2 to secondary. From this output, ops manager determines which replica set member is the primary. Jan 07, 2018 setup a mongodb cluster aka replica set on ubuntu after one day and a half, bouncing between various resources, i finally managed to make a mongodb replica set work. To perform an initial sync, see resync a member of a replica set.
Restore a replica set from a backup mongodb ops manager 3. With mongodb atlas, a failure to one of my nodes will no longer require manual intervention to recover to a fully operational threenode replica set. If, in that time frame, you create a new cluster with the same name, atlas reassigns the reserved public ip address to that cluster cluster ip addresses dont change when clusters are paused then resumed. The backup agent automatically detects and converts snapshot data in bindata subtype 2 to bindata subtype 0. When you stop backups for a replica set or sharded cluster ops manager stops taking new snapshots but retains existing snapshots until their listed expiration date.
When you shut down a process, cluster, or replica set, ops manager continues to manage it, even though it is not running. Deploying mongodb and replica sets using containers ibm. See stop mongod processes for instructions on safely terminating mongod processes. Replication in mongodb a replica set is a group of mongod instances that maintain the same data set. The shell then automatically reconnects in such cases. Run a mongodb replica set locally for development and clear the.
Returns a document that reports on the status of the replica set. If you later restart backups for replica set or cluster, cloud manager might perform an initial sync, depending on how much time has elapsed. As it is my habit, i log my steps in a blocnote for easy back tracking and effort saving for the future it happens to everyone, but i get so annoyed to search twice a solution. Adding a new mongod process also updates the list of processes in the replica set configuration section. Create a configuration file for each replica set member including data directory, log file, port number, and replica set name. If you later restart backups for replica set or cluster, ops manager might perform an initial sync, depending on how much time has elapsed. The command to start a replica set in the mongodb shell is itiate.
After performing all maintenance tasks, restart the mongod instance as a replica set member with its original configuration. A developers guide to mongodb replica sets severalnines. Ensure that any writes on this standalone do not conflict with oplog writes that will be applied to the member when it rejoins the replica set. Live migrate your replica set to atlas mongodb atlas. Mongodb is the most popular nosql, documentbased database in the market and this handson lab will help you understand how to deploy mongodb using containers as well as creating a replica set for high availability purposes. Debeziums mongodb connector can monitor a mongodb replica set or a mongodb. If you closed the restore panel, click backup, then restore history. Perform maintenance on replica set members mongodb. What the guys over at mongo decided to do is to basically challenge the way we think about these topics by combining them into replica sets. Similarly, do the same thing from the remaining servers. Feb 26, 2016 a replica set in mongodb is a group of mongod processes that utilize the same data set. Debezium mongodb source connector for confluent platform.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Once you reach the cutover step in the following procedure, you should stop writes to the source cluster by stopping your application instances, pointing.
If set to true, the alert configuration is enabled if enabled is not specified in a post command, it defaults to false matchers. Setup a mongodb cluster aka replica set on ubuntu mohamed. By default, when mongorunner shuts down a mongod node, it will call waitpid on the underlying process before continuing. When the mongodb connector stops, it records the last oplog position that it. Nov 15, 2017 mongodb supports horizontal scaling through sharding. If you want to reuse the existing mongod as a standalone server rather than a replica set member then the. But to stop mongo db, i need to run open mongo shell first and then type two commands. A replica set is a group of mongod instances that maintain the same data set. Mongodb may disconnect the shell briefly if the replica set needs to elect a new primary. If your application code expects bindata subtype 2, you must update your application code to work with.
Replica sets provide redundancy and high availability, and are the basis for all production deployments. There are commands to reconfigure the set or remove members but no way that i know off to remove the last member and therefore destroy the replica set. In short a replica set is a combination of replication, backups, high availability, scalability and distributed data access combined. The bson specification changed the default subtype for the bson binary datatype bindata from 2 to 0. This is used by mongodb instances to authenticate in a replica set and sharded clusters. All members in the replica set must share the same name. We will use the mongo1 server as primary node, and mongo2 and mongo3 as secondary nodes. How to reset mongodb replica set settings server fault. Using the oplog from the source, the mongod updates its data set to reflect the current state of the replica set. The configuration of config server replica set is done. Follow the tutorial from the mongodb manual to restore the replica set.
Optional click pause to stop rtpp from displaying incoming data. When you stop backups for a replica set or sharded cluster cloud manager stops taking new snapshots but retains existing snapshots until their listed expiration date. Convert a standalone to a replica set mongodb ops manager 4. The resource and corresponding endpoints use the term groups. Replica set secondaries stop replicating during reindex. View and download mongodb logs view and download the logs for your mongodb deployments. Downgrade each secondary member of the replica set, one at a time.
In this step, we will configure 4 centos 7 servers as shard server with 2 replica set. Simply download the connectors plugin archive, extract the jars into your kafka. Using either a package manager or a manual download, get the latest release in the 3. Deploy a standalone mongodb instance mongodb cloud. Mongodb supports horizontal scaling through sharding. A replica set contains several data bearing nodes and optionally one arbiter node. When you restore a replica set from backup, ops manager provides you with a restore file for the selected restore point. Timestamp in iso 8601 date and time format in utc when this alert configuration was created updated. If you want to keep the data, but start outside a replica set, just restart the mongod process without the replset and on a different port. Login to the mongo1 server and start the mongo shell. Your migration source must be an existing mongodb replica set.
Debezium connector for mongodb debezium documentation. Perform maintenance on replica set members mongodb manual. When the restore job completes, select the download link next to the snapshot. Of the data bearing nodes, one and only one member is deemed the primary node, while the other nodes are deemed secondary nodes. A replica set in mongodb is a group of mongod processes that utilize the same data set. Any mongod instance that is neither part of a replica set or sharded cluster nor used as a config server primary. Deploy a mongodb database in the cloud with just a few clicks.
If you select this option, ops manager prompts to choose the replica set to which to restore. To learn about replica sets, see deploy a replica set. There are commands to reconfigure the set or remove members but no way that i know off to remove the. Mongodbs jira will be unavailable for scheduled maintenance from 14. Furthermore, this particular sequence strives to minimize the amount of time that the primary is unavailable and control the impact on the entire deployment. This template deploys a mongodb replica set on centos and enables zabbix monitoring this azure resource manager arm template was created by a member of the community and not by microsoft. Mongodb then uses this oplog to replicate the writes to the other members in the replica set. How to stop mongo db in one command stack overflow. Then restart the mongodb service and enter the shell again. Each member of the replica set will have its own folder. Initiate the replica set from the mongo1 server with the query below. Mongodb database images using images openshift enterprise. Jul 22, 20 shut down the standalone mongod instance.
If, in that time frame, you create a new cluster with the same name, atlas reassigns the reserved public ip address to that cluster. Enables or disables a maintenance mode, which puts a secondary node in a recovering state. Nov 25, 2017 the command to start a replica set in the mongodb shell is itiate. This tutorial will describe how to setup a mongodb replica set with three members. When you terminate a cluster, atlas reserves the clusters public ip address, bound to its original cluster name, for 36 hours. Connect to the mongo shell on the primary server and initiate replica set. Displays the collections with the most operations as reported by mongotop. Download and use for free for development environments. To be completely sure that the replica set configuration is gone from the instance, make.
1251 214 1591 500 126 167 112 1408 594 239 192 1194 416 1593 1498 843 556 896 343 258 133 86 1033 883 1453 796 421 500 13 327 230 834 1318 14